Intermediate knitters with some hand sewing abilities will do fine with this pattern.

Yarn Requirements: worsted-weight yarn, approx 440 yds of main color, 220 yards of contrasting color, and 255 yds of bulky acrylic boucle yarn in main color .

Accessories: Two 18mm round beads, buttons or safety eyes for eyes. 

Gauge: no gauge
Needle Size: #13US 16" needle and #13US DPN needles
Difficulty: Intermediate
